What is the Business Owners Insurance Application?

The Business Owners Insurance Application is a vital form utilized in the United States to secure business insurance. This document captures essential information about the business, including general details, risk factors, and prior insurance history. Completing this application accurately is crucial for business owners aiming to manage risks effectively and ensure compliance with legal standards.
It is imperative that applicants provide comprehensive information, as the data will determine the coverage options available. Specific sections require details such as business operations, location, and ownership structure, which are integral to assessing risk and determining suitable insurance products.

Who Needs the Business Owners Insurance Application?

Essentially, all types of businesses, including small, medium, and start-ups, should consider filling out the Business Owners Insurance Application. This form is particularly critical for businesses under lease agreements or those engaging with clients or customers that require proof of insurance coverage.
Various industries may have specific insurance mandates, making this application integral for establishing a solid foundation for liability coverage. Understanding the specific situations that necessitate this form can greatly enhance a business's risk management strategy.

What Happens After You Submit the Business Owners Insurance Application?

After submission, the application enters a review process where underwriting teams assess the provided information. The time frame for approval can vary, and understanding potential outcomes is vital for business planning.
Possible outcomes of the application process include:
  • Approval of the insurance coverage as requested.
  • Rejection due to incomplete or inaccurate information.
  • A request for additional information or corrections before processing further.
